disabled macros in document
I'm not finding what I'm looking for when I search.
I have a document, that when I open it has the Macro options grayed out. It also has forms on it that I cannot seem to change. Other documents that I have opens normally, so it must be some start- up macro/code embedded in this document. Is there a way that I can disable this so I can open the document to make modifications to it? Thanks |

disabled macros in document
It sounds likely to be a protected form. Unless it is password-protected,
you can probably use Tools | Unprotect Document to unlock it. If that doesn't work, then you can insert it into a new blank document (using Insert | File), which removes the protection. -- Suzanne S.
